American Renaissance Revival bombe' oak pedestal, late 19th century, attributed to R.J. Horner, having a triangular top with canted corners, above a shaped apron with carved rosettes at the corners, surmounting the standard depicting a Northwind mask over a carved foliate motif, flanked in carved scrolling acanthus, rising on paw feet, and terminating to a tripartite plinth, 33"h x 20"w x 17.5"d.
